BOB MARLEY'S JAMAICAN JERK CHICKEN SKEWERS
From Emeril Lagasse Emeril Live show, this has gotten great reviews! This is served at the Marley Cafe in Orlando, Florida. This is traditionally served with cucumber sauce and yucca fries(you can sub french fries). I have given the recipe for the sauce. Prep time includes marinating overnight. Steps:
- Marinade:.
- Mix together onion, scallion, thyme, salt, sugar, allspice, nutmeg, cinnamon, hot pepper, black pepper, soy sauce, oil and vinegar. These ingredients can also be combined in a food processor.
- Skewer 2 1/2 ounces of chicken onto each skewer(about 4 pieces). Place the skewers in a shallow baking dish and cover with the marinade. Marinate in the refrigerator overnight.
- Place the skewers onto a hot grill and grill until done, about 2 to 3 minutes per side.
- For the dipping sauce:.
- Peel and seed cucumbers and roughly chop. Add sour cream and mayonnaise. Add rest of ingredients and puree in a blender. Yield: about 1 1/2 quarts.

JERK CHICKEN SKEWER WITH JERK SAUCE

Steps:
- Cut the chicken into 20 thin strips, about the size of your small finger. Thread onto 1end of each skewer and place into a bowl until marinade is ready. Keep the bamboo handles all on 1 side so as not to touch the marinade when it is added.
- In a food processor, place the rest of the ingredients and blend until smooth.
- Pour 1/2 the marinade over the chicken only, trying not to touch the skewers. Make sure to coat the chicken entirely. Let sit in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ours.
- Place the remainder of the marinade into a small saucepan and add:
- Place over medium heat until thickened and the tomato has broken down, about 30 minutes. Puree, if desired for a smoother consistency. Let cool and serve with the chicken skewers when they are ready.
- To finish, place the chicken end of the skewers over a hot, well-oiled grill and cook about 3 minutes per side. Time might vary depending on how hot the grill is or how thick the chicken is. If a grill is not available, you can place under a broiler for about the same time. Serve with the jerk sauce.
JAMAICAN JERK CHICKEN SKEWERS
Jamaican Jerk sauce is a delicious blend of sweet, spicy and savory flavors by combining ingredients like orange juice, brown sugar, chili, cinnamon, ginger, garlic, etc. I am marinating chicken skewers in my homemade Jamaican Jerk marinade overnight for maximum flavor. Steps:
- In a mixing bowl, combine all of the ingredients except for the meat. Set aside.
- On a cutting board, slice the chicken thighs into 2 inch chunks. Place the chunks into a large resealable plastic bag. Pour the marinade in the plastic bag, seal, and move it all around with your hands, to ensure that the meat is completely covered. Refrigerate overnight.
- To assemble the skewers, soak wooden skewers in water for 30 minutes. Place chicken on skewers. Preheat a grill to medium heat, and grill until meat is cooked through (about 8 minutes in a covered grill, turning once). Serve immediately.
